Transaction 109f4d615639f35c93e0450f37a8aa7fb01393259c1f4b00153a6576fa29be17
1 Input
1 Output
-
109f4d615639f35c93e0450f37a8aa7fb01393259c1f4b00153a6576fa29be17:0
- value
- 35358235
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a15c5644dc847c24b0b368caaa6e29cfd7265952 OP_EQUAL
- address
- MNcMe12duzy9P89CZdfTbja1k5vm1GYqJs